Within the arena of fiscal control, picking the right bookkeeping method is vital for exact history-retaining and selection-making. One of the more frequently used methods is definitely the cash-basis accounting. As opposed to its comparable version, the accrual technique, which records transactions once they occur regardless of if the dollars actually modifications hands, the bucks strategy acknowledges profits and expenditures only if cash is exchanged. Here is all you should learn about this fundamental bookkeeping strategy.

The Way It Works:

Your money technique is easy. Businesses report revenue when it's gotten and expenditures when they're paid for. For example, when a services-dependent organization receipts a person in January but doesn't acquire transaction until Feb ., the cash flow is captured in February underneath the cash technique, not January if the assistance was provided.

Simpleness and Lucidity:

One of several primary great things about your money way is its simpleness. Small enterprises, in particular, discover it simpler to deal with their budget using this approach as it closely reflects the particular income. In addition, it provides a specific picture of methods much cash is accessible at any given time, creating budgeting and economic preparation much more straightforward.

Income tax Consequences:

Numerous small companies choose the money method for taxation functions. Given that income isn't accepted until it's received, they may defer income taxes by postponing the invoice of monthly payments or accelerating expenses. This versatility permits enterprises to control their taxation financial obligations more effectively, specially during tough economical periods.

Restrictions:

As the money method provides straightforwardness and income tax advantages, furthermore, it has constraints. Because it doesn't take into account accounts receivable and accounts due, it may not provide an correct representation of the company's long term financial health. This may be bothersome for companies that count heavily on credit score purchases or have significant excellent financial obligations.
